Tea, berries and apples: products that slow down aging named

Products rich in flavonoids, such as black tea, berries, and apples, can help maintain health in older age and slow down aging processes.
As reported by BAKU.WS, scientists from Australia, Ireland, and the USA came to this conclusion. The results of the large-scale study were published in the journal The American Journal of Clinical Nutrition (AJCN).
Flavonoids are natural compounds found in vegetables, fruits, tea, and coffee. They have anti-inflammatory properties, protect blood vessels, and help maintain muscle mass. All these factors are especially important with age.
The study covered almost 90 thousand people aged over 24 years. In women with high flavonoid consumption, the risk of developing physical weakness decreased by 15%, and the likelihood of mental disorders and mobility impairments by 12%. In men, the flavonoid diet had a particularly positive effect on mental health - the risk of its disorders decreased by 15%.
According to Professor Aedin Cassidy from Queen's University (Ireland), it is enough to include just three additional servings of flavonoid products in the diet daily to significantly reduce the risks of age-related problems.
